MR to ultrasound image registration with segmentation‐based learning for HDR prostate brachytherapy
Abstract
Purpose Propagation of contours from high‐quality magnetic resonance (MR) images to treatment planning ultrasound (US) images with severe needle artifacts is a challenging task, which can greatly aid the organ contouring in high dose rate (HDR) prostate brachytherapy.
